I recently created my own unlocked copy of the Lemonade database (the one used by the game scanner for CRC matches). To use it, I would replace the "...\Lemonade\Data\lmn.cab" file with my update (the same filename, in the same directory) and then run Lemonade's game scanner as usual. I've just now run the game scanner with my modified lmn.cab file and everything worked perfectly.

Providing enough people are interested and providing the authors are okay with it, I would be happy to release my unofficial updates here as they make them (whenever I have some time to go ROM hunting among the TOSEC collection and update some entries). The updated .cab files could be password protected like the latest official Lemonade update.

I will begin with the 216 games that are already in the database but as of yet have no associated CRC data. So far, the only modification I've made has been for "Flashback" : to use a different image set (some parts of the game are in French with the original entry), and also changed it from A600 to A500 to avoid the strange problem that causes gun-fire to become muted (http://www.lemonamiga.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=2710).

I just discovered that Lemonade doesn't support ISO very well, and would force the user to manually mount / insert CD32 discs. Seeing as a large amount of the games marked as unplayable are CD32 - it seems like this may not be quite as good as I had hoped, but there are still a fair amount of non-CD32 games missing from the database.
